Jalaladin Muhammad Akbar (1556-1605) was one of the greatest rulers of Indian history. Although a Muslim himself, he practiced a policy of tolerance of Hinduism, the religion of the majority of his subjects. He was a formidable warrior that led an impressive war machine, but he also used diplomacy as a tool to reach his goals, forging alliances with some local Hindu rulers when possible, and even marrying princess Jhoda Bai, a Hindu noble woman, for political reasons.

Westernize - to adopt the culture of Western European countries
Divine right - belief that God created the monarchy to act as his representative.
Armada - a large fleet of warships
Boyar - high-ranking Russian nobility and landowner
Ideal - existing as a perfect example.
